The Participant Folder screen is used to access a client's records. A folder is created to store information for any person who begins the application process for participation in the local WIC program.

When the Participant Folder screen first displays, if an attempt to establish a connection to the EBT Processor system occurs and the attempt is unsuccessful, a standard error message (E0393) displays.

When the Participant Folder screen first displays, if required information is missing for one or more risk factors in the Reference Utility application module, a standard information message (I0090) displays.

If there are pending voids for benefits on the Food Adjustment Wizard screen, the Participant Folder is locked for the entire household. When the Participant Folder screen is displayed, the system displays the I0008 standard information message.

If there are no risk factors assigned for the current certification, when the Participant Folder screen is displayed, the system displays the E0345 standard error message.

When the Participant Folder is opened, a check is performed to determine the folder is already opened for the current ID. If the folder is already opened for the current ID, the system displays the E0365 standard error message.

If the Common Area web service is not accessible, the system displays the E0339 standard error message.

If the Common Area web service does not support a particular web method, the system displays the E0340 standard error message.

If the Common Area web service returns a communication error from IBM Content Manager during a query for data or search, the system displays the E0341 standard error message.

If the Common Area web service call times out during a query for data or search, the system displays the E0342 standard error message.

If the Common Area web service call loses connectivity during a query for data or search, the system displays the E0343 standard error message.

If the Common Area web service returns an exception when data is being inserted or updated from MOWINS, the system displays the E0344 standard error message.

Interface Initialization

Upon initial display of the screen, the following occurs:

  • The title bar text is set to "[MEMBER.FIRSTNAME MEMBER.MIDDLEINITIAL MEMBER.LASTNAME] - {descriptive value of age} - WIC ID: [MEMBER.STATEWICID] Household ID: [MEMBER.HOUSEHOLDID]", where {descriptive value of age} equals:

  • For infants, display "XX" Months "XX" Days, calculated from the Date of Birth.

  • For children, display "XX" Year(s) "XX" Months "XX" Days calculated from the Date of Birth.

  • For pregnant women, display "XX" weeks gestation calculated from the LMP start date.

  • For pregnant women without an LMP date, display "XX" Year(s) calculated from the Date of Birth.

  • For breastfeeding and non-breastfeeding women, display "XX" Years calculated from the Date of Birth.

  • The tab title is set to "Participant Folder".

  • If the participant or a member of the participant's household is flagged for an Alert, upon opening the participant's folder, the Display Alerts screen is displayed.

  • If the participant was certified with a pending ID proof selection, upon opening the participant's folder, the CPA Review screen is displayed with a "Proof of Income Required" alert.

  • Once a folder is opened, depending on the WIC Category of the participant (or applicant) the folder enables only those tabs and controls that apply to only the WIC Category of the participant. Refer to the respective tabs for specific information on Participant Folder tabs and sub-tabs.

  • The default tab displayed when the Participant Folder is opened will be the first available tab for which the user is granted permission. Refer to Security. When the user has "View Only" permission for a specified tab, the controls on the tab will be locked and the values cannot be modified. When the user permissions are 'None' for a tab, the tab is disabled and not available for selection. Participant Folder tabs

The Participant Folder screen contains multiple tabs along the top of the screen for viewing information about a participant. These tabs are designed to mimic a paper-based hanging file folder, are labeled according to their content, and display unique screens containing information specific to each tab when clicked. In addition, some tabbed pages are similar to sub-folders and contain additional tabbed pages, called sub-tabs, within them. Depending on your current permission level, you may not be able to access each and every tab or sub-tab available. To display an available page of information, click the tab for that page.

Edits

Navigating among the tabs of the participant folder does not display the edit and save processing until data is modified. If data is modified on a specific tab, the following actions display the edit routines:

Standard Processing of Participant Folder Edits and Save Routines

If changes are made on a tab within the Participant Folder and the user attempts to exit the folder, exit the application or move onto another tab within the system, the system displays the C0002 standard confirmation message. Yes, No, and Cancel buttons are available.
